On 1/7/2020 8:18 PM, Randy Dunlap wrote:
> On 1/7/20 9:38 PM, Edwin Zimmerman wrote:
>> Fix cast-to-pointer compiler warning
>>
>> arch/x86/boot/compressed/acpi.c: In function âget_acpi_srat_tableâ:
>> arch/x86/boot/compressed/acpi.c:316:9: warning: cast to pointer from integer of different size [-Wint-to-pointer-cast]
>> rsdp = (struct acpi_table_rsdp *)get_cmdline_acpi_rsdp();
>> ÂÂÂ ÂÂÂ ^
>> Fixes: 41fa1ee9c6d6 ("acpi: Ignore acpi_rsdp kernel param when the kernel has been locked down")
>> Signed-off-by: Edwin Zimmerman <edwin@xx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x>
>> ---
>> arch/x86/boot/compressed/acpi.c | 2 +-
>> 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)
>>
>> diff --git a/arch/x86/boot/compressed/acpi.c b/arch/x86/boot/compressed/acpi.c
>> index 25019d42ae93..5d2568066d58 100644
>> --- a/arch/x86/boot/compressed/acpi.c
>> +++ b/arch/x86/boot/compressed/acpi.c
>> @@ -313,7 +313,7 @@ static unsigned long get_acpi_srat_table(void)
>> * stash this in boot params because the kernel itself may have
>> * different ideas about whether to trust a command-line parameter.
>> */
>> - rsdp = (struct acpi_table_rsdp *)get_cmdline_acpi_rsdp();
>> + rsdp = (struct acpi_table_rsdp *)(long)get_cmdline_acpi_rsdp();
>> if (!rsdp)
>> rsdp = (struct acpi_table_rsdp *)(long)
